SV62 NKS is a 2012 Suzuki SX4 in Orange with a 1,586cc petrol engine. This vehicle has been through 21 MOT tests with a personal pass rate of 52.4%.
Across all 2012 Suzuki SX4 models, the average MOT pass rate is 74.7% with a typical mileage of 50,232 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Suzuki SX4 fails its MOT is coil spring broken, accounting for 10,592 recorded failures. If you're considering buying SV62 NKS, it's worth having these areas checked by a mechanic before committing.
The Suzuki SX4 typically stays on UK roads for around 20 years. At 14 years old, this Suzuki SX4 is well into its expected lifespan but still has years ahead.
